Transaction ed45fad3610270568b641875cc45d9599c34583120af2aec9a5fd9b030f5141e
1 Input
2 Outputs
- ed45fad3610270568b641875cc45d9599c34583120af2aec9a5fd9b030f5141e:0
- ed45fad3610270568b641875cc45d9599c34583120af2aec9a5fd9b030f5141e:1
value 360000
address 3DXY9UgvJurauFM3x8zQx64KKDGeiLqCMA
value 3109633
address 164aDG95RM7hFzKDanwHSyrrj1aTuLnF1s